Our summertime tour features the remarkable scenery of the Khan Khentii and Asralt mountain ranges, one of the world's last large wildernesses. The Khan Khentii includes a Strictly Protected Area over a peak worshipped by Mongolians. We travel by Mongolian ox-cart through a spectacular valley, picturesque place of high cliffs on the Baruunbayan River to visit The Princess Temple. Experience the feelings of peace and tranquility that leisurely travelling by ox-cart in the wild brings.

Tourist Ger camp: (Ger facilities) During your trip in the countryside, you’ll overnight in ger camps. Make yourself comfortable in a ger (2-4 beds). Each camp has a ger restaurant. Most camps are equipped with toilets and showers with other possibilities for entertainment.
Guest Ger camp:: (Ger facilities) During your trip in the countryside, you’ll occasionally overnight in guest ger camps. It’s more casual or less touristy decorated comparing to tourist luxury ger camps. Most guest ger camps are not equipped with flush toilets or hot showers.
by the nomadic family: Traditionally, nomad families used to leave 1 extra ger for random visitor’s sudden visit. Nowadays its a fading tradition but has found new life as tourists have started coming to Mongolia. Providing a sustainable extra income to nomadic families and providing for meaningful cultural exchanges, spare gers in the countryside are far more interesting to stay in than some tour camps.
Japanese van: (4 wheel vehicle) over the last several years Japanese vans have been successfully running for tourist services all over Mongolia. They have good air conditioning systems and are more comfortable to ride in which is appreciated by many of our clients.
Purgon (Russian van): Purgon is a grey colored van guaranteed for Mongolian bumpy roads and it holds 7 people easily. It’s suitable for longer trips and for those who are keen to save some transport expenses. We would suggest the van if you are heading off into remote areas such as western Mongolia or the Gobi.
